3299 Andrei Elkin 2011-06-16
wl#5569 MTS
fixing slave_parallel_workers_basic and rpl_stop_middle_group which cant run in MTS
modified:
mysql-test/extra/rpl_tests/rpl_stop_middle_group.test
sql/sys_vars.cc
3298 Andrei Elkin 2011-06-16
wl#5569 MTS
adding new tests to sys_vars.\
added:
mysql-test/suite/sys_vars/r/slave_parallel_workers_basic.result
mysql-test/suite/sys_vars/r/slave_pending_jobs_size_max_basic.result
mysql-test/suite/sys_vars/t/slave_parallel_workers_basic.test
mysql-test/suite/sys_vars/t/slave_pending_jobs_size_max_basic.test
=== modified file 'mysql-test/extra/rpl_tests/rpl_stop_middle_group.test'
--- a/mysql-test/extra/rpl_tests/rpl_stop_middle_group.test 2011-03-29 13:44:23 +0000
+++ b/mysql-test/extra/rpl_tests/rpl_stop_middle_group.test 2011-06-16 16:46:22 +0000
@@ -5,6 +5,10 @@
# The matter of testing correlates to some of `rpl_start_stop_slave' that does
# not require `have_debug'.
+# Test group sematics and thereby failing in such group is bound to
+# the Single-Threaded Slave.
+-- source include/not_mts_slave_parallel_workers.inc
+
connection master;
call mtr.add_suppression("Unsafe statement written to the binary log using statement format since BINLOG_FORMAT = STATEMENT");
=== modified file 'sql/sys_vars.cc'
--- a/sql/sys_vars.cc 2011-06-15 17:12:11 +0000
+++ b/sql/sys_vars.cc 2011-06-16 16:46:22 +0000
@@ -3353,7 +3353,7 @@ static Sys_var_ulong Sys_slave_parallel_
"slave_parallel_workers",
"Number of worker threads for executing events in parallel ",
GLOBAL_VAR(opt_mts_slave_parallel_workers), CMD_LINE(REQUIRED_ARG),
- VALID_RANGE(0, ULONG_MAX), DEFAULT(0), BLOCK_SIZE(1));
+ VALID_RANGE(0, UINT_MAX), DEFAULT(0), BLOCK_SIZE(1));
static Sys_var_ulonglong Sys_mts_pending_jobs_size_max(
"slave_pending_jobs_size_max",
Attachment: [text/bzr-bundle] bzr/andrei.elkin@oracle.com-20110616164622-dw4qjppy0tjo4x8d.bundle
| Thread |
|---|
| • bzr push into mysql-next-mr-wl5569 branch (andrei.elkin:3298 to 3299) WL#5569 | Andrei Elkin | 16 Jun |